Interpret Meaning in English

word

/ˌɪnˈtɝpɹət/
in-TUR-pruht
/ɪntˈɜːpɹɪt/
in-TUR-pruht

释义

To explain the meaning of something or to translate spoken words from one language to another.

用法与细微差别

Used both for explaining meaning ('interpret the data') and for oral translation ('interpret for the visitor'). Usually formal or academic. Common collocations: 'interpret a dream', 'interpret the law', 'interpret for someone'. Not the same as 'translate', which is for written language.
